EXLS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

338 of the 6,221 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in EXL Service (EXLS)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$5.16B — up 9.2% from $4.73B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 51 funds opened new EXLS positions and 24 closed out — a net gain of 27 holders — while 98 added to existing stakes and 154 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$51.1M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$77.5M.
